The world’s best-known love story with a new ending: & Julia, the hit musical, will premiere in Finland in autumn 2026

What happens if Juliet doesn’t follow Romeo but chooses life? The musical & Juliet, which charmed audiences in London and Broadway, updates Shakespeare’s classic to the present day by challenging the idea that a woman’s story is dependent on a man. The end result is a sprawling, attitude-filled pop delight with hit songs by Britney Spears, Bon Jovi and Katy Perry, among others, which will be directed to HKT’s big stage by the musical wizard Samuel Harjanne. This is the question posed in The Musical & Julia, in which William Shakespeare and his wife Anne Hathaway rewrite the ending of the classic – Juliet gets to choose differently and start over. There are many levels that run side by side in the musical. Shakespeare and Hathaway brainstorm, write and comment on Juliet’s new story, which Shakespeare’s theatre troupe performs on stage.& Julia is an energetic jukebox musical where the 16th century theatre world meets the disco and party aesthetics of the 21st century. “Let’s shake the dust off Shakespeare! The genius of the musical Jukebox is measured by how skillfully the scriptwriters weave the flow of the story together with the lyrics of hits known to everyone. It creates such speed and energy that the audience will definitely not be able to stay in their seats at the end of the thank you at the latest,” says theatre director Kari Arffman.
